The 6th Houston Film Critics Society Awards nominations were announced on December 15, 2012.[1] The 2012 awards were given out at a ceremony held at the Museum of Fine Arts on January 5, 2013. The awards are presented annually by the Houston Film Critics Society based in Houston, Texas.
